Introduction
This workflow outlines an automated process for redacting sensitive information, utilizing advanced technologies such as artificial intelligence and machine learning. It encompasses various stages, from document intake and classification to final delivery, ensuring efficiency, accuracy, and compliance throughout.
Document Intake and Classification
- Documents are received through various channels, including email, scanners, and file uploads.
- AI-powered classification tools automatically categorize documents by type.
- Metadata is extracted and indexed to enhance searchability.
Optical Character Recognition (OCR)
- Documents are converted into machine-readable text using OCR technology.
- AI enhances OCR accuracy, particularly for handwritten or low-quality documents.
Sensitive Information Detection
- AI algorithms scan documents to identify potentially sensitive information.
- Pre-defined patterns, such as Social Security numbers and credit card numbers, are detected.
- Machine learning models recognize context-specific sensitive data.
Automated Redaction
- Identified sensitive information is automatically redacted.
- AI applies appropriate redaction methods, including black boxes and text replacement.
- Redaction reasons are logged for auditing purposes.
Human Review and Quality Control
- Redacted documents are presented to human reviewers for verification.
- AI-assisted review tools highlight potential issues or missed redactions.
- Reviewers can make manual adjustments as necessary.
Document Export and Delivery
- Final redacted documents are exported in appropriate formats.
- AI ensures that all metadata and hidden information are also redacted.
- Documents are securely delivered to the intended recipients or systems.
AI-Driven Tools for Enhancement
1. Intelligent Document Processing (IDP)
Tools such as Google Cloud’s Document AI or Amazon Textract can be integrated to enhance document intake, classification, and data extraction. These platforms utilize machine learning to comprehend document structure and content, facilitating more accurate processing.
For instance, the Document AI Workbench could be employed to create custom document models for government-specific form types, thereby improving classification accuracy and data extraction from unique document formats.
2. Advanced OCR and Natural Language Processing (NLP)
Integrating sophisticated OCR and NLP tools, such as those provided by ABBYY or Kofax, can enhance text recognition and understanding. These tools are better equipped to handle complex layouts, multiple languages, and handwritten text.
For example, ABBYY’s NLP capabilities could be utilized to comprehend context and identify sensitive information that may not conform to standard patterns, such as descriptions of classified operations or locations.
3. AI-Powered Redaction
Specialized redaction tools like Objective Redact or AutoRedact can be integrated to improve the accuracy and efficiency of the redaction process. These tools leverage machine learning to identify and redact sensitive information more effectively.
For instance, AutoRedact’s pattern search and redaction templates could be customized for government-specific sensitive information, such as classified project names or security clearance levels.
4. Automated Workflow Management
Integrating AI-driven workflow management tools, such as those offered by Softdocs, can streamline the entire redaction process. These tools can automate document routing, approval processes, and status tracking.
For example, Softdocs’ AI-powered document classification could automatically route different document types to the appropriate departments or reviewers based on content and sensitivity level.
5. Machine Learning for Continuous Improvement
Implementing a machine learning system that learns from human reviewer corrections can continuously enhance the accuracy of automated redaction over time.
For instance, an online learning system could analyze reviewer edits to refine redaction knowledge, achieving 95-99% accuracy with minimal human intervention over time.
Process Improvements with AI Integration
- Enhanced Accuracy: AI-driven tools can significantly reduce human error in identifying and redacting sensitive information.
- Increased Efficiency: Automation of repetitive tasks allows government employees to concentrate on higher-value work.
- Scalability: AI-powered systems can manage large volumes of documents more effectively, addressing the growing demand for document processing in government agencies.
- Consistency: AI ensures a standardized approach to redaction across various document types and departments.
- Compliance: Advanced AI tools can be customized to adhere to specific government regulations and policies, ensuring consistent compliance.
- Cost Reduction: By minimizing manual labor and processing time, AI integration can lead to significant cost savings for government agencies.
- Improved Security: AI-driven systems can provide enhanced security measures, such as encryption and access controls, to protect sensitive information throughout the redaction process.
By integrating these AI-driven tools and improvements, government agencies can establish a more efficient, accurate, and secure automated document redaction workflow. This enhanced process not only protects sensitive information more effectively but also enables agencies to manage increasing document volumes while reducing costs and improving service delivery to constituents.
